Abstract AR

تم في هذا البحث فحص مستخلصات المذيبات العضوية (ثنائي اثيل الايثر، خلات الاثيل و الكحول الإثيلي) للريفولاريا و الأسيلاتوريا سالاينا التي تم تجميعها من ساحل مدينة مصراتة ليبيا على نمو 6 أنواع من البكتيريا الممرضة sp., E.

faecalisAcinetobacter P.

aeruginosa, S.

aureus, E.

coli و P.

Mirabilis.

و لقد تم اختبار تأثير هذه المستخلصات باستخدام طريقتي انتشار حفر الاجار (agar well diffusion) و انتشار القرص (disc diffusion).

و لقد تبين من هذه الدراسة أن مستخلص ثنائي اثيل الايثر للريفولاريا له تأثير مثبط على نمو P.

Mirabilis (5mm) و على Acinetobacter sp.

(5mm)، في حين أن مستخلص خلات الاثيل له تأثير أقل على نمو P.

Mirabilis (2mm) و على Acinetobacter sp.

(3mm).

أما مستخلص الكحول الاثيلي للريفولاريا فلم يكن له أي تأثير على أي نوع من البكتيريا المدروسة.

بالنسبة للأسيلاتوريا سالاينا فإن مستخلص ثنائي أثيل الإيثر أظهر تأثير بسيط على نمو Acinetobacter sp.

(2mm).

أما المستخلصين الآخرين فلم يكن لهما أي تأثير مثبط على نمو أي نوع من البكتيريا المدروسة.

Abstract EN

Objectives : in vitro screening of organic solvent (diethyl ether, ethyl acetate and ethanol) extracts of Rivularia species and Oscillatory saline were carried out against some pathogenic bacteria E.

coli, S.

aureus, P.

aeruginosa, E.

faecalis, Acinetobacter species and P.

mirabilis.

Methods : Two marine cyanobacteria Oscillatoria salina and Rivularia species were collected from Mediterranean Sea shore, Maserati, Libya.

Both cyanobacteria strains were extracted with diethyl ether, ethyl acetate and ethanol.

In vitro screening of antibacterial activity of the crude extracts was carried out against six common pathogenic bacteria E.

coli, S.

aureus,..aeruginosa, E.

faecalis, p Acinetobacter species and P.

mirabilis.

The extracts were tested in compliance with the agar well diffusion and disc diffusion method for their antibacterial activity.

Results : diethyl ether extract of Rivularia species showed moderate inhibitory activity against P.

mirabilis (5mm) and Acinetobacter species (5mm) and ethylacetate extract of that species showed little activity against Acinetobacter species (3mm) P.

mirabilis (2mm).

Ethanol extract of Rivularia species showed no activity to that selected bacteria.

Diethyl ether extract of Oscillatory saline showed little activity only against Acinetobacter species (2mm) and the remaining two solvent extracts had shown no activity against that above mentioned pathogenic bacteria.

Conclusion : diethyl ether crude extract of Rivularia species possessed noticeable antibacterial activity against gram negative bacteria when compared with standard Ampicillin and Streptomycin.

It is evident from the present study that the diethyl ether and ethyl acetate extract of Rivularia species could be utilized as an antibacterial agent in pharmaceutical industry.
